Pepper Kuzhambu ~ Pepper in Tamarind Gravy from Ratatouille




I like pepper kuzhambu very much but never made, but I always wanted to try it.  One day I was just browsing my reader and saw the recipe (Milagu Kuzhambu) in Chitra blog it was simple, I tried it found it was yummy.  I did few changes in the recipe like adding ginger and saute the cumin pepper masala, here pepper kuzhambu my way.  Thanks Chitra for sharing the recipe :)

Ingredients:

Cumin Seeds - 1tbsp
Black Pepper Corns - 1 tbsp
Mustard Seeds - 1/2 tsp
Fenugreek/Methi Seeds - 1/2 tsp
Peal Onion - 6 pieces [ 1/4 Cup chopped]
Tomato - 1 medium [ 1/2 Cup chopped]
Garlic - 2 tbs [chopped ]
Ginger - 1/2 tps [optional]
Curry leaves - 4-5 leaves
Turmeric Powder - 1/2 tsp
Tamarind - 1 small lemon size
Oil - 1 tbsp
Salt - to taste
Water

Method:

1. Roast cumin seeds followed by pepper corns in a pan, allow it to cool and grind it to course powder.

2. Soak tamarind in 1 cup water for 15-20mins, extract the tamarind water/juice and keep aside.

3. Chop ginger, garlic, onion and tomato keep aside.

4. In a pan heat oil add mustard seeds and allow it to crack, add fenugreek seeds & curry leaves and saute for 30sec.




5. Add chopped ginger, garlic and saute for a min.  Add chopped onion and saute until onion turns light brown.

6. Add chopped tomato and saute for 2mins in medium heat or until it get mash.



7. Add powder turmeric, cumin & pepper masala and saute for 2-3 mins.



8. Add tamarind extract and salt and cook for 7-8 mins in medium flame.

I think mine should have been cooked more to get thick kuzhambu as I liked that way.  This is a simple and yummy recipe and sure for me try again. (on the side is yellow pumpkin curry, I shall post later)
